Introduction to CPA Marketing and Traffic Monetization
CPA marketing, also known as cost-per-action marketing, is a form of affiliate marketing that involves promoting products or services and earning a commission for each action taken by a customer. Traffic monetization is the process of converting website visitors into revenue. Free Options for CPA Marketing and Traffic Monetization
There are several free options available for CPA marketing and traffic monetization, including search engine optimization (SEO), social media marketing, and content marketing. SEO involves optimizing website content to rank higher in search engine results pages (SERPs), while social media marketing involves promoting products or services on social media platforms. Content marketing involves creating and sharing valuable content to attract and engage with target audiences.

Paid Options for CPA Marketing and Traffic Monetization
Paid options for CPA marketing and traffic monetization include pay-per-click (PPC) advertising, affiliate networks, and sponsored content. PPC advertising involves paying for each ad click, while affiliate networks involve partnering with other companies to promote their products or services. Sponsored content involves paying for product or service placements in content.
